Movie Review : Mirapakaya
Rating : 3 / 5 Banner : Yellow Flowers
Cast : Ravi Teja, Richa Gangopadhyay, Deeksha Seth, Prakashraj, Kota, Ajay, Supreeth, Sunil, Brahmaji, Ravu Ramesh, Ali, Naga Babu, Chandramohan, Surekha Vani, Dharmavarapu, Sudha and Others Action : Ram Laxman Cinematography : Ramprasad Editor : Gowtham Raju Music : Thaman
Producer: Ramesh Puppala
Director: Harish Shankar
Released Date: January 13, 2011 |
|
|
Story: A fast moving tale, the story begins with Rishi (Ravi
teja) who is a smart and tough intelligence officer but he likes to flirt with
girls and wants to experience the emotion of love. He is sent to Hyderabad on a
mission and is told to take up the post of a lecturer in a college. Here he sees
Vinamra (richa) and it is love at first sight for him. Even Vinamra also likes
him. But trouble comes in the form of Vaishali (deeksha) a new student. Rishi's
mission is to get close to Vaishali. What is that mission and whether Rishi
succeeds or not forms the rest of the story.

Presentation: The director has
come up with a routine storyline and while the presentation was nice, the
narrative was decent. The dialogues were good, the script was tight and the
screenplay got better. Background score was very nice and songs are the
highlight. Cinematography is the plus point for the film. Editing was sharp at
the required places. Costumes were mismatch and failed to impress while the art
department was very good. Ravi Teja as usual steals the show with his punch
dialogues, witty lines, high energy levels and body language. Richa looks good
and she suits the role of the Brahmin girl. Deeksha has a contrasting appeal and
she looks sizzling hot. Prakashraj was brief, Kota was excellent, Supreeth was
usual, Ravu Ramesh was regular. Sunil, Ali, Praveen, Brahmaji gave few light
moments. The others did their bit as required.
|
Conclusion: The film is basically
a commercial entertainer and it followed the formula rightly. As such, the story
doesn't really take off in the first half, it is all the lighter elements like
the romance, songs, fights, comedy. The real story begins during the second half
and breezes of. Though the climax part was weak, overall the film runs high on
technical values and the pace also helps providing good entertainment. At the
box office, this has a strong chance of becoming a commercial success.
Bharatstudent
Verdict: Regular masala, can be watched once |
